Violent storms caused damage and injuries in many French speaking cantons last night.
Several regions in Vaud, Neuchatel, Fribourg and Jura suffered heavy rain, wind and hail.
In Bulle in Fribourg, six children and a woman were taken to hospital for checks after being caught in a hail storm.
Fribourg police say they had 300 calls in a matter of minutes asking for help with flooding. Firefighters were called to stop the overflowing of a stream and fallen trees blocked roads.
Across the region, hail damaged cars, roofs and broke windows.
